Clifford Celdran tops Thailand Friendly golfest

CEBU, Philippines - Clifford Celdran topped the 1st Thailand Friendly Golf Tournament dubbed as “Believe in Thailand Meeting on the Green in Cebu” played at the par-72 Cebu Country Club yesterday.

Celdran, who is also the general manager of the host club, fired a tournament-best gross score of 79 strokes and established as System-36 handicap of 9 for a net 70. After going seven-over par on the front nine, Celdran shot back-to-back birdies on the 10th and 11th to finish the back nine at one-over-par.

The first runner-up honors went to Toby Florendo also with a net score of 70 strokes off a gross 80.  He established a System-36 handicap of 10.

Ties in this tournament format are broken by virtue of a lower established handicap.

Jovi Neri also finished with a net score of 70 but had a handicap of 11 to finish as second runner-up.

The tournament was organized by the Thailand Convention and Exhibition Bureau.

Puripan Bunnag, senior manager Marketing and Promotions of the Meeting and Incentives Department said that a similar event will be held in Manila tomorrow. – NLQ (THE FREEMAN)
